TO JUDGE bp 01/03/2018 P.B.SURESH KUMAR, J. --------------------------------------------- W.P.(C) No.6836 of 2018 --------------------------------------------- Dated this the 1st day of March, 2018 JUDGMENT Petitioner is an assessee under the Income T ax Act (the Act) on the rolls of the first respondent. Aggrieved by Ext.P1 series assessment orders, the petitioner preferred Ext.P2 series appeals before the second respondent. Ext.P3 series are the applications for stay preferred by the petitioner in Ext.P2 series appeals. The grievance of the petitioner in the writ petition concerns the delay on the part of the second respondent in passing orders on Ext.P3 series applications for stay. It is alleged by the petitioner in the writ petition that proceedings have already been initiated for realisation of the amounts covered by Ext.P1 series orders. The petitioner, therefore, seeks appropriate directions in this regard, in this writ petition. 2.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ner as also the learned Standing Counsel for the respondents. Having regard to the facts and circumstances of the case, I deem it appropriate to dispose of the writ petition WPC 6836 /18 -:2:- directing the second respondent to take a decision on Ext.P3 series applications for stay, within two months from the date of receipt of a copy of this judgment. Ordered accordingly. This shall be done untrammelled by the orders, if any, passed by the competent authorities under the Act in exercise of their powers under sub-section (6) of Section 220 of the Act. Needless to say that until orders are passed on Ext.P3 series applications for stay, further proceedings for realisation of the amounts covered by Ext.P1 series assessment orders shall be deferred.
